What Is a Wastewater Evaporator and How Does It Work? 

How Wastewater Evaporators Work 

At its core, a wastewater evaporator uses heat to convert liquid wastewater into vapour, leaving behind concentrated residues for safe disposal. Think of it as boiling water on a stove—but scaled up for industrial demands. The process involves: 

  1. Heating: Energy is applied to evaporate water. 

  1. Separation: Vapour is condensed back into water (often reusable). 

  1. Concentration: Residual solids are collected for disposal. 

This method is highly effective for industries like pharmaceuticals, textiles, and chemicals, where wastewater contains complex contaminants. 

Types of Wastewater Evaporators 

Not all evaporation systems fit every scenario. Common types include: 

1. Thermal evaporators are ideal for high-salinity or toxic wastewater. 

2. Mechanical Vapour Compression (MVC): Energy-efficient for large-scale operations. 

3. Solar Evaporators: Leverage sunlight for low-energy needs. 

A custom wastewater evaporator might be necessary if your facility has unique flow rates, waste compositions, or space constraints.

Key Factors to Consider While Selecting a Wastewater Evaporator Manufacturer 

Industry Experience and Expertise 

Would you hire a chef to fix a car? Probably not. Similarly, prioritise manufacturers with a proven track record in your sector. For instance, a wastewater treatment solutions provider familiar with India’s textile industry will understand dye-laden wastewater better than a generalist. 

Ask: 

1. How many years have they served your industry? 

2. Do they comply with CPCB (Central Pollution Control Board) standards? 

Technology and Innovation 

A high-efficiency wastewater evaporator isn’t just about specsit’s about smart engineering. Look for features like automated controls, corrosion-resistant materials, or heat recovery systems. Manufacturers investing in R&D are more likely to future-proof their investment. 

Customisationn Options 

Off-the-shelf solutions rarely fit all. Whether you need a compact evaporator for wastewater in a confined space or a system that handles fluctuating waste volumes, customisation is key. 

Energy Efficiency and Cost Savings 

An energy-guzzling system defeats the purpose of cost-effective wastewater management. Opt for manufacturers that prioritise high-efficiency wastewater evaporator designs, which reduce power consumption while maximising output.

Common Mistakes to Avoid While Selecting a Manufacturer 

1. Prioritising Cost Over Quality 

Choosing a cheaper industrial wastewater evaporator might seem budget-friendly initially, but it’s a gamble. Low-cost systems often cut corners on materials, technology, or durability, leading to frequent breakdowns, higher energy consumption, and costly repairs. Imagine facing unexpected downtime because a critical component failed—how much would that disrupt your operations? Over time, these “savings” vanish, replaced by inflated maintenance bills and non-compliance risks. A quality wastewater evaporation system from a trusted manufacturer ensures reliability, longevity, and compliance, making it a smarter long-term investment. Don’t let short-term gains compromise your efficiency. 

2. Ignoring After-Sales Support 

Even the best evaporator for wastewater can encounter issues, whether it’s a technical glitch or wear and tear. Without robust after-sales support, you’re left scrambling for solutions, risking prolonged downtime and operational chaos. Will your team handle complex repairs on their own? Reliable manufacturers offer maintenance packages, access to spare parts, and 24/7 technical assistance, ensuring minimal disruption. This support isn’t just “nice to have”; it’s critical for sustaining the performance of your wastewater treatment solutions and meeting regulatory requirements. Always verify the manufacturer’s post-installation commitment before signing. 

3. Overlooking Customization 

No two industries generate identical wastewater. A generic industrial evaporator might struggle with your facility’s unique contaminants, flow rates, or space constraints. Picture forcing a one-size-fits-all system into a specialised workflow—it’s like using a spoon to dig a trench. Customisation tailors the high-efficiency wastewater evaporator to your specific needs, optimising performance and compliance. Whether adjusting evaporation capacity or integrating corrosion-resistant materials, bespoke designs ensure seamless integration. Always partner with manufacturers offering custom wastewater evaporator solutions—because your challenges deserve precision, not compromises.
